Efficient Routing Protocol in the Mobile Ad-hoc Network (MANET) by using Genetic Algorithm (GA)
Journal Title: IOSR Journals (IOSR Journal of Computer Engineering) - Year 2014, Vol 16, Issue 1
Abstract
An Ad hoc network is a collection of wireless mobile hosts forming a temporary network without the aid of any centralized administration or standard support services. MANET can be defined using unstable network infrastructure, self-organizing network topology and independent node mobility. This becomes obtainable due to their routing techniques; in other terms, routing is a backbone for MANET. However, due to network load routing performance of MANET is degraded thus, some optimization on network routing strategy is required. In this paper, we introduce a new technique by using the concept of Genetic algorithm (GA) with AODV Protocol to make routing decision in computer network. The goal of this paper is to find the optimal path between the source and destination nodes and increased the QoS and Throughput. We implemented and compare this a new technique with the traditional AODV, and we shows that the new technique is better performance than the traditional AODV.
